Women's Hockey Skates to 2-2 Tie with #10 Harvard

PRINCETON (11/13/10) - Kelly Cooke and Corey Stearns scored goals and Rachel Weber made 30 saves as the Princeton women's hockey team skated to a 2-2 tie with 10th-ranked Harvard on Saturday afternoon at Hobey Baker Rink.
Princeton had leads of 1-0 and 2-1 in the tie, but Harvard was able to even the score both times. Cooke opened the scoring midway through the first period with her first goal of the season off an assist from Alex Kinney. Princeton held the lead through the middle of the second when the Crimson knotted it up on a goal from Katharine Chute.
Tied at one entering the third period, Princeton jumped back ahead just 20 seconds into the third period as Stearns netted her third of the season with an assist from Danielle DiCesare. The lead last until the 15:49 when Chute scored from the off wing to draw the Crimson even.
Harvard outshot Princeton 32-22 in the game. Weber made 30 saves for the tie while Harvard's Lauren Joarnt had 20.
Princeton is now 3-5-1 overall and 3-3-1 in the ECAC, while Harvard is now 2-2-2 both overall and in league play. Princeton visits Cornell next Friday.
